“I had no idea where I was in the air,” Biles said in an interview on the “Today” show, speaking of her performance in a team event. “You can literally see it in my eyes in the pictures, like I was petrified.”
Biles, who won four gold medals and a bronze in the 2016 Olympics, went on to win bronze on the balance beam in Tokyo, a medal that meant “more than all the golds, because I’ve pushed through so much the last five years and the last week,” she said in a “Today” show interview.
The experience, she said, allowed her to realize that she is “more than my medals in gymnastics. I’m a human being, and I’ve done some courageous things outside of this sport,” she said in the interview.
“I don’t think, if this situation didn’t happen, I would have never seen it that way,” she said.
After four Olympic golds and 19 world championship titles, the 24-year-old has brought about a wider discussion on the mental health challenges facing top-performing athletes, an amazing feat in itself.

Rest and therapy
Biles’ coach, Cecile Canqueteau-Landi, said the star athlete is “openly talking about therapy, and that’s what she’s going to go through.”
Some much-deserved R&R also looks to be in Biles’ future.
The Gold Over America Tour
She and other star gymnasts, including Laurie Hernandez and Jordan Chiles, will be touring 35 cities throughout the United States to celebrate female athletes.
“I love the sport of gymnastics and wanted to help create a show that celebrates the pure joy of performing,” Biles said in announcing the tour.
Paris in 2024?
Will Biles compete in the Paris Olympics in 2024?
“I just need to process this whole thing first,” she said at a news conference in Tokyo when asked that question.
Later, in an interview on the “Today” show, she said she’s “keeping the door open” to the Paris games.
Her coaches are French, and Biles in the past has indicated she might compete there to honor them.
Coaching, of course, is another possibility down the line.
